: Dear Ms. Durbak, could you help me please with your legal advise. I have H1-B visa and I have applied for the Labor Certification, so my file is still in the Labor Department but my H1-B will expire soon. Can I extend my visa for one year before my case go the INS? I know I can get an extension of my visa while case is pending in INS

If you write to me directly, I will answer your questions. I do not give information about specific cases on the bulletin board.
In general, it is possible to renew H-1bs until one has been in that status in the US for 6 years. Under certain circumstances, if one has a Labor Certification Application or an I-140 pending, it is possible to renew the H-1B for even longer. If you had an attorney handling your case until now, that is the best person to answer your questions, because s/he would know all of the details of your case. If you want to write to me, you need to give me more details. How long have you been in H-1B status? Were there any interruptions of that status? How long has the labor certification been pending?
